Auger:


This is also known as a drain serpent as well as is used for clearing drainpipe obstructions. This device is inserted right into obstructed drains to take out clogs and substances from the drain. You put it in the drainpipe and spin it to damage blockages into tinier little bits for easy cleaning.

A basin wrench:


This is one more tool that needs to be in every residence. When doing plumbing repairs, it may be essential to chill out bolts and sink plumbing components. The basin wrench makes this possible and is likewise utilized to tighten nuts as well. This wrench has a head that pivots at the back and front. This helps to get to smaller nuts or hold the faucet knobs as well as pipes.

Pliers:


The type of pliers recommended for plumbing is the tongue-and-groove pliers. Pliers are really valuable devices for Do it yourself plumbing professionals.

Teflon tape:


This is likewise frequently called plumber's tape. It is made use of to securely secure heap joints and also suitable. The tapes remain in rolls cut to particular sizes and also widths. It is an impervious seal and due to this, it can be utilized to hold back leakages till specialist help gets here.

Bettor:


Plunger is a really great tool for resolving plumbing problems. It is made use of to clear blockages in commodes, cooking area sinks, as well as other drains pipes in your house.

8 Must Have Plumbing Tools for Homeowners


A CUP PLUNGER


Did you know there are different types of plungers? They are all made to remove clogs, but some work better for different types of jobs. A cup plunger is the plunger with the traditional design that most people are familiar with. It is essentially a rubber cup on the end of a stick. Some have short plastic handles and others long wooden ones. It is designed to unclog drains that sit on a flat surface such as those found in bathtubs, sinks or showers. You simply lay the cup flat over the drain and push straight down to make the seal. Pull the stick up to create negative pressure to remove the clog from your plumbing system. You may have to work your cup plunger for a while depending on the stubbornness of the clog.


A FLANGE PLUNGER


A flange plunger is another member of the plunger family, but it is made to do different work than its cousin, the cup plunger. The flange plunger has a wooden stick and a rubber base with a cup formation at the bottom of it. This makes it easier to fit into a toilet’s drain and remove debris that is clogging the pipe. The design of this plunger also makes it useful for unclogging sinks. But, it’s best to have a separate plunger to use for your sinks and toilets. You don’t want to spread germs and bacteria by using one plunger for every item in your home.


A PIPE WRENCH


A pipe wrench is a valuable item to have in your collection of tools. It is a durable tool that should last you for years. The width of its serrated jaws can be adjusted to get a firm grip on all types of pipes. So, when you install a pipe under a sink or elsewhere, a pipe wrench can help you ensure that the connection is tight. Or, if you have to take out a pipe that needs to be replaced due to wear & tear over the years, a pipe wrench allows you to get a solid hold on the pipe in order to disconnect it from other connections. If you’re in the market for a new pipe wrench, take some time to try some in-person. Pick up a few in the store to a get a feel for the grip and weight of the tool. This can help you to select one that you’re comfortable using.


PLUMBERS PUTTY


A tube or container of plumber’s putty is another must-have for your tool box. It looks just like regular putty but is used to make a seal that is water tight. You may apply it around a faucet or put some around a drain in a bathroom sink. This putty serves as an extra barrier to prevent leaks.
